¡Bienvenidos a Laax, Suiza! Este encantador destino es perfecto para las parejas que buscan una escapada romántica en la nieve. Laax es conocida por su impresionante paisaje montañoso y su variada oferta de pistas de esquí, que son ideales tanto para esquiadores como para snowboarders. La calidad de la nieve y la pendiente de las pistas son factores clave que hacen de este lugar un paraíso invernal.
Durante la temporada de esquí, que generalmente va de diciembre a abril, Laax ofrece un clima fresco y nevado. Las temperaturas pueden variar entre -5°C y 5°C, así que asegúrate de llevar ropa de abrigo adecuada. La atmósfera es vibrante, con turistas de todo el mundo disfrutando de la nieve y la hospitalidad suiza. Los sonidos de risas y el crujir de la nieve bajo los esquís llenan el aire, creando un ambiente alegre y festivo.
La gastronomía local es otro aspecto que no debes perderte. Prueba el fondue de queso, un plato tradicional que se comparte entre amigos y seres queridos, lo que lo convierte en una experiencia perfecta para las parejas. Además, no olvides degustar los rösti, un delicioso plato de papas fritas que es un clásico en la región. Una cena romántica en un restaurante acogedor puede costar alrededor de 60-80 CHF para dos personas.
En cuanto al transporte, Laax es fácilmente accesible desde Zúrich, y puedes llegar en tren y autobús por aproximadamente 30-50 CHF por persona. Dentro de Laax, puedes utilizar el transporte público o alquilar un coche; el costo del transporte local es accesible, alrededor de 20 CHF por día.
Las tradiciones locales también añaden un toque especial a tu visita. En invierno, es común ver a los lugareños celebrar el festival de luces, donde las calles se iluminan con decoraciones festivas. La música tradicional suiza, como el yodel, puede escucharse en algunos de los bares y restaurantes, creando un ambiente acogedor y auténtico.
Si planeas disfrutar de las actividades en la nieve, ten en cuenta que el alquiler de equipo de snowboard puede costar alrededor de 50-70 CHF por día. Las clases de esquí, si deseas aprender o mejorar tus habilidades, oscilan entre 100-150 CHF por persona por medio día. Las entradas para el telesilla también son importantes; un pase diario cuesta alrededor de 70 CHF por persona.
En total, un viaje de 4 días a Laax para una pareja podría costar aproximadamente 1,200-1,500 CHF, incluyendo alojamiento, comidas, transporte y actividades. Este valor puede variar dependiendo de tus preferencias y el nivel de lujo que busques.

Weather in Laax during ski season (typically December to April) is characterized by crisp, cold temperatures, often sunny days, and occasional snowfall. Pack warm layers, including waterproof outerwear and comfortable thermal base layers. Don’t forget your hats, gloves, and scarves!
Laax's culinary scene is a delight! Indulge in traditional Swiss dishes like fondue (expect to pay around CHF 30-40 per person), raclette (similar price range), or hearty Rösti (CHF 15-25). You'll find plenty of charming restaurants and cafes offering both Swiss specialties and international cuisine. A romantic dinner with a view of the mountains will surely be a highlight.
The local architecture is a charming mix of traditional Swiss chalets with their distinctive wooden structures and modern, sleek ski resorts. You’ll see a blend of rustic charm and contemporary design, creating a visually appealing landscape.
Transportation within Laax is easily managed with the efficient ski lift system. Getting to Laax from Zurich Airport typically involves a train to Chur, followed by a bus to Laax (total travel time approximately 3-4 hours, costing around CHF 80-100 per person). Once in Laax, the ski lifts connect all the key areas. For a multi-day lift pass, expect to pay around CHF 250-350 per person.
Regarding local traditions, while Laax is a modern ski resort, remnants of Swiss culture remain. You might encounter local festivals or events depending on your travel dates. The people are generally friendly and welcoming, though perhaps a little reserved initially. Learning a few basic German phrases can go a long way.
Typical costs for a 5-day/4-night trip for two people, including accommodation (mid-range hotel), lift passes, food, and transportation from Zurich, could range from CHF 2000 to CHF 3500. This is an estimate and can vary depending on your choices of accommodation and dining.

Laax, during ski season (typically December to April), offers a unique blend of exhilarating slopes and charming Swiss culture. Expect temperatures ranging from -5°C to 5°C, but be prepared for colder spells and wind, especially at higher altitudes. Visibility can fluctuate, so always check the weather forecast before heading out. The wind can be quite strong at times on the mountain peaks, adding a touch of adventure (and maybe a chill) to your skiing experience.
Picture this: you and your loved one, bundled up in warm layers, gliding down pristine slopes. The air is crisp, the snow sparkles under the sun, and the only sounds are the swoosh of your skis and your happy sighs. Laax is known for its fantastic snowboarding and freeriding terrain as well, offering something for all skill levels. A day pass for the slopes costs approximately CHF 50-70 (€45-65) per person, varying slightly depending on the season and day of the week. Consider renting skis or snowboards; expect to pay around CHF 40-60 (€35-55) per day per person.
After a day on the slopes, warm up with a hearty Swiss meal. Fondue and raclette are quintessential dishes – melted cheese with bread or potatoes, perfect for sharing and sparking romantic conversations. You can find a casual restaurant for around CHF 30-50 (€27-45) per person, or opt for a more upscale dining experience for CHF 60-100 (€55-90) per person.
The charm of Laax extends beyond the slopes. Explore the village, with its traditional Swiss architecture – charming chalets with wooden beams and cozy fireplaces. The locals are friendly and welcoming, often speaking German (though English is widely spoken in tourist areas). You might hear the lively sounds of traditional Swiss music in some restaurants and bars. Look for local handicrafts and souvenirs to remember your trip. The atmosphere is generally relaxed and joyful, with couples enjoying romantic strolls and sharing moments of connection amidst the scenic beauty.
Transportation within Laax is easily managed by the free ski bus system which connects all areas of the resort. For transportation to and from the airport or other destinations, consider trains or taxis; these can add significantly to the cost, varying from CHF 50 to CHF 200 (€45-180) per person depending on the distance.
Beyond skiing, enjoy the peacefulness of the snowy landscapes. Perhaps consider snowshoeing or a romantic horse-drawn sleigh ride. These activities add a touch of magic to your trip, but do factor in their cost; they typically range from CHF 50-100 (€45-90) per person.
Remember to pack warm, waterproof clothing! Comfortable layers are essential for keeping warm and dry during your adventures. Don't forget sunscreen – the snow reflects sunlight, and you can easily get sunburned.
So, what's the total cost? A 3-day/2-night romantic getaway to Laax, including slopes, rentals, meals, and some activities, could cost around CHF 1000-1500 (€900-1350) per couple, depending on your choices. But remember, the memories you'll create are priceless!
